In other words, in comparison to arteries, venules and veins withstand a much lower pressure from the blood that flows through them. Their walls are considerably thinner and their lumens are correspondingly larger in diameter, allowing more blood to flow with less vessel resistance. WebThe walls of the veins have three layers; how-ever, they are much thinner than those of arteries. The lumen of the vein is much larger than that of ar-teries and can, therefore, accommodate more blood than arteries. Hence, the veins may serve as blood reservoirs. WebAug 19, 2024 · Capillaries have very thin walls comprised only of endothelial cells, which allows substances to move through the wall with ease. Capillaries are very small, measuring 5-10 micrometres in width. However, the cross-sectional area of capillaries within an average size muscle would be larger than that of the Aorta.

Their size is between 10 and 30 micrometers and are too small to contain smooth muscle. They are instead supported by pericytes that wrap around them.
